- Montreal beat Boston 3-2 in overtime Friday, with rookie Nicole Gosling scoring 38 seconds into the extra period on a power play.
- The victory locked the Victoire into a top-two finish and secured home-ice advantage for the first playoff round.
- The result put Montreal at 60 points to Boston’s 58 with two regular-season games left, and the league’s leader will pick its semifinal foe.
- Jade Downie-Landry and Kaitlin Willoughby scored for Montreal, while Jessie Eldridge and Daniela Pejšová tied it for Boston before overtime as Ann-Renée Desbiens made 26 saves.
- Boston started backup Abbey Levy, who stopped 28 shots with Aerin Frankel not dressed, and the teams now turn to their final week with Montreal visiting Vancouver Tuesday and Boston hosting Ottawa Wednesday.
